Industries suffocating due to shortage of oxygen cylinders in Aligarh

Monday, 21 September 2020 | Pradeep Saxena | Aligarh

During the corona period, the brass statue and hardware business of Aligarh have suffered a major loss. Due to the dwindling demand for hardware and statues and the shortage of oxygen gas has shocked the businessmen.  Three plants of the city are not refilling the gas cylinder due to a shortage of liquid due to which 80 percent manufacturing unit of brass sculptures are closed, more than 1000 welding units are also closed including small ones.

 Due to the absence of welding, the factories of wright, Polish, etc are also not getting orders. Some profiteer dealers and plant operators are selling 350 rupees oxygen cylinders for up to 1200 rupees. There is tremendous black marketing of oxygen cylinders. Despite having information, the administrative officers are not taking any action.

There is a shortage of oxygen cylinders used in industrial units since 24th August. Oxygen gas is used in Hardware, Brass & Silver idols, Statue, Fridge, AC, and other job works, for this the factories of the city need 3000 cylinders daily. Now the supply is shrunken to only 10% which affects the idol and hardware business.

These units are used to get cylinders from the refilling plant in the city. The operators of these 3 refilling plants in the city prepared oxygen from the liquid. There was no lack of oxygen in the industries and healthy service till the last week of August but with the increasing corona patients, oxygen demand also shoots up.

The brass idols and hardware are a multi-million business of the city. The brass idol business has an annual turnover of Rs 500 crores while the annual turnover of the hardware business is Rs 20,000 crores.

A 10 cubic meter capacity oxygen cylinders are generally used in the industries which cost Rs 350, but this cylinder sold on 1st September in Rs 550. After 6 days, it was sold at an elevated price of Rs 450 and a few days later its price increased to Rs 1000. Dealers also billed the same amount of money without fear. There were also complaints about less gas in many cylinders.

Idol manufacturer Kapil Varshney said that he bought 2 cylinders from his hardware business friend for Rs 2400. He further said that orders have to be completed and delivered before Navratri. There is tremendous black marketing on the name of the oxygen gas shortage. Cylinders are being sold from different places rather then godown.

Job worker Lokesh Sharma said that he is doing job work and not getting the cylinder for the last 3 days but today he bought Rs 350 cylinder in Rs 1200 and that too without any bill. The administration is not paying attention. Thousands of workers have become unemployed due to the closure of the factories.

Deputy Commissioner Industries, Srinath Paswan told that the government issued an order to supply cylinders to the health sector on priority. District Magistrate and Divisional Commissioner have been informed that industries are not getting oxygen. Had discussions with businessmen as well. Modi Nagar plant will be going to start from 1st Oct, after that we are hoping to get enough and uninterrupted supply.

Refilling plant owner Suresh Chandra told that plants preparing oxygen gas for industries are not getting liquid for refilling. We also have business relationships with businessmen. Since the last days, there has been a rift in these relations. The rate of Liquid has been increased up to 3 times. The administration should interfere in this matter.

Vipin Bihari Gupta, Director of the brass statue and hardware manufacturers and supplier association said that festivals like Navratri and Diwali are near. The market is already affected badly due to the corona pandemic and now we are battling for oxygen. The livelihood of thousands of people got affected. 80% of production is already stopped.
